Australia is renowned for its stringent gambling regulations designed to protect consumers. The legal framework covers everything from land-based casinos to interactive online gambling.
Australian Communications and Media Authority (ACMA)
The ACMA oversees online gambling regulations, particularly focusing on licensed and prohibited betting services in Australia.
Australian Transaction Reports and Analysis Centre (AUSTRAC)
AUSTRAC monitors financial transactions associated with gambling activities to curb money laundering and ensure lawful fund movement.
State Liquor and Gaming Authorities
Each state and territory has specific regulators responsible for granting licences and monitoring gambling venues and operators.
Interactive Gambling Act 2001 (IGA)
This federal legislation bans certain forms of online gambling services to Australians while allowing regulated and licensed operators to function.
State-specific Casino and Gambling Acts
Various states (e.g., Victoria, New South Wales, Queensland) have their own laws regulating gambling establishments.
Understanding this regulatory mesh helps players verify if a gambling operator is legally compliant and safe to use.

Fairness is crucial. Trusted operators use certified Random Number Generators (RNGs) to ensure unpredictability and fairness in games. These RNG systems are independently audited by third parties like eCOGRA or iTech Labs to validate randomness.
